New year, free cash

We’ve compiled a list of grants and subsidies you can apply for ASAP.

Welcome to the start of Q1. We’re moving into a year of weaker economic growth, so keep those budgets manageable with a few different funding sources you can apply for this new year. 

Get moving: many of these applications close as early as next week!

Scaling innovation

High-growth businesses are eligible to apply for up to $10 million from Pacific Economic Development Canada until Jan. 31. The Business Scale-Up and Productivity Program offers interest-free, repayable funding. Learn more >> 

Apply for a minimum contribution of $10 million from the Strategic Innovation Fund to accelerate technology transfer, commercialization, and ecosystem building across Canada. Learn more >> 


Wage subsidies

Have 50 or fewer full-time employees and are looking to hire staff for the summer? Canada Summer Jobs is accepting applications until Jan. 12. Learn more >> 

If you’re tackling climate action, the Pacific Institute for Climate Solutions will provide $12,000 to hire a student intern. Applications are due Jan. 12.
Learn more >> 

Biotech companies seeking to employ skilled newcomers can apply for up to $20,000 in wage subsidies from BioTalent Canada. Learn more >> 

Climatetech

Technology that accelerates the journey to net-zero carbon can apply for the BC Centre for Innovation and Clean Energy’s Open Call for Innovation starting Jan. 16 until Feb. 10. The program will award up to $6 million in non-dilutive grant funding. Learn more >> 


Women, Two-Spirit, trans, and non-binary people

Social enterprises that lead or serve any or all of these populations can apply for up to $75,000 from the Canadian Women’s Foundation until Jan. 18. Enterprises must apply in partnership with a registered charity, municipality, or other qualified donees as indicated by the federal government. Learn more >> 

Creative industries

Interactive and digital media innovators can apply for a reimbursement of up to $2,500 from CreativeBC to access international markets or conferences, as well as co-production or co-financing events. Applications must be submitted at least three weeks prior to the event. Learn more >> 

Creative industries associations are eligible for support from CreativeBC to attend major international festivals and markets. Learn more >>
